Originally released in 2017. Orizaba's Peak is a comedy/drama film. directed by Jaime Fidalgo. At just 11 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Juan Pablo Castañeda, Luis Alberti, and Tato Alexander

Synopsis

In a cozy bistro, an increasingly heated discussion between two good buddies reveals their latent sexual prejudices, as one admits to feeling finally set free by a book he has just read.
